Short story:

The Rolling Thunder Revue, a traveling cavalcade of Bob Dylan and his long-time musical comrades, plays its first show, at the War Memorial Auditorium, Plymouth, Massachusetts, USA.

Full article:

Roger McGuinn (guitar/vocals) : It was a great big rolling party, two or three tour buses out there with all your friends. I sat next to Joni Mitchell on the bus, and Joan Baez was there and T-Bone Burnett and Bobby Neuwirth and Mick Ronson and Ramblin' Jack Elliot. It was amazing.
